Looks like LG is planning to stay in the limelight for a significant portion of the year, first with its newly announced LG G3 flagship, and now, by announcing the next versions of the G Flex and Vu handsets - the G Flex 2 and Vu 4.

LG G3 has not yet gone off the news and the Korean tech firm has already confirmed the launch of the G Flex 2 and Vu 4 smartphone and phablet devices for the second half of this year. LG announced the news in a press conference in Seoul parallel to the launch of LG G3, reports IT Today Korea (via Phonearena).

To recall, LG G Flex (Review | Pictures) was one of the first smartphone's to live up to the name of 'flexible display' along with an innovative 'self-healing' back panel.

LG did not mention any other details of the upcoming LG G Flex 2 and Vu 4 smartphones at the event, so until the firm officially reveals the handsets, we would be depending on leaks and rumours. Speculation for the G Flex 2 is already pointing towards a better display and a unique aspect ratio.

The H2 2014 launch of the G Flex 2 contradicts the release date that was leaked by @evleaks last week. The tipster tweeted "LG G Flex 2 coming mid-Q1 2015, possibly with a feature even more unique than self-healing plastic."

Like LG G Flex, the Vu 3 phablet device failed to make a major mark in the markets. We expect the Vu 4 to at least include full-HD screen resolution as its predecessor came with a 960x1280 pixel resolution.

Since the G Flex and Vu 3 were correspondingly introduced in October and September last year, we assume both G Flex and Vu 4 will arrive in the same period this year.
